Not by a big one. But once for fun, I had this two footer in the sink and it was bouncing up and down with its mouth open. So I wondered if it was faking. So I found a little plastic bottle and went to stick it in its mouth. Well the bloody thing did not bite the bottle, it bit my knuckle and bulldoged it. hahahahahahahahahahahaha. I got one good tooth hole on top my knuckle. Other then bleeding like a stuck pig, there was no other problems.

I have been tested by several adults, but not has ever actually biten me. I also respect their abilities. But it could happen. To be tested is to have mock bite. That is mouth you, but not harm you.

I normally go in their cages and hand feed them. sometimes a male will get a little pushy and I simply push them away with my tennis shoe. Sometimes they mouth it too, but have never really bit my shoe either. I learned the shoe thing from an australian reptile keeper. Cheers
